Can you get golden hour in the morning?

When does the golden hour occur? The golden hour occurs twice during the day: In the morning, it begins when the Sun is at -4º of elevation and it ends when the Sun is at 6º above the horizon. It matches the end of the civil twilight, just after the blue hour.

Is dawn and sunrise the same thing?

Dawn is the time of morning when the Sun is 6° below the horizon. Respectively, dusk occurs when the Sun is 6° below the horizon in the evening. Sunrise is the time when the first part of the Sun becomes visible in the morning at a given location.

What is a false dawn seen before sunrise called?

The zodiacal light (also called false dawn when seen before sunrise) is a faint, diffuse, and roughly triangular white glow that is visible in the night sky and appears to extend from the Sun's direction and along the zodiac, straddling the ecliptic, which is the plane of Earth's orbit around the Sun.

What are the phases of sunrise?

Nautical twilight begins when the Sun is 12 degrees below the horizon in the morning. Civil twilight begins when there is enough light for most objects to be distinguishable. Civil twilight, lasts until sunrise. Civil dawn occurs when the Sun is 6 degrees below the horizon in the morning.

What time is blue hour?

Blue hour usually lasts about 20–30 minutes right after sunset and right before sunrise. For instance, if the Sun sets at 6:30 p.m., blue hour would occur from 6:40 p.m. to 7 p.m.. If the Sun were to rise at 7:30 a.m., blue hour would occur from 7 a.m. to 7:20 a.m..

Is golden hour longer in winter?

In the summer, you might only get an hour or so of golden hour light, but in the winter, the sun never gets high overhead, so the golden hour light is available much longer, giving you more time to shoot!
